#233419 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#233419 is composed of 13.7% red, 20.4%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.9% yellow and 79.6% black. It has a hue angle of 97.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.1% and a lightness of 15.1%. #233419 color hex could be obtained by blending #466832 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#233419 color description : Very dark desaturated green.

#233419 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#233419 has RGB values of R:35, G:52,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 2307097.

Shades and Tints of #233419

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080c06 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#233419

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#262825 is the less saturated color, while #1d4c01 is the most saturated one.
